About M. Lough
M. Lough is a scholar working on Aerospace Engineering, Environmental Engineering, Computational Mechanics, Computational Theory and Mathematics and Mechanical Engineering, having authored 19 papers that have together received 882 indexed citations. Recurring topics across this work include GNSS positioning and interference (9 papers), Inertial Sensor and Navigation (6 papers), Advanced Mathematical Modeling in Engineering (6 papers), Groundwater flow and contamination studies (5 papers), Hydraulic Fracturing and Reservoir Analysis (5 papers), Advanced Numerical Methods in Computational Mathematics (3 papers), Geophysics and Gravity Measurements (3 papers) and Astronomical Observations and Instrumentation (3 papers). The work is most often cited by research in Environmental Engineering (382 citations), Ocean Engineering (360 citations), Mechanical Engineering (563 citations), Geophysics (134 citations) and Mechanics of Materials (234 citations). M. Lough has collaborated with scholars based in United States, Netherlands and China. Frequent co-authors include C. L. Jensen, Jairam Kamath, Louis J. Durlofsky, R. Muellerschoen, Willy Bertiger, S. Lowe, John L. LaBrecque, Bruce Haines, L. E. Young and S. M. Lichten. Their work appears in journals such as Water Resources Research, SPE Reservoir Evaluation & Engineering, SPE Journal, Physics of Fluids and IEEE Transactions on Geoscience and Remote Sensing.
